QGIS API Documentation 3.30.0-'s-Hertogenbosch (f186b8efe0)
|
Contains placement information for a curved text layout. More...
#include <qgstextrendererutils.h>
Public Attributes | |
bool | flippedCharacterPlacementToGetUprightLabels = false |
true if the character placement had to be reversed in order to obtain upright labels on the segment More... | |
QVector< QgsTextRendererUtils::CurvedGraphemePlacement > | graphemePlacement |
Placement information for all graphemes in text. More... | |
bool | labeledLineSegmentIsRightToLeft = false |
true if labeled section of line is calculated to be of right-to-left orientation More... | |
int | upsideDownCharCount = 0 |
Total count of upside down characters. More... | |
Contains placement information for a curved text layout.
Definition at line 121 of file qgstextrendererutils.h.
bool QgsTextRendererUtils::CurvePlacementProperties::flippedCharacterPlacementToGetUprightLabels = false |
true
if the character placement had to be reversed in order to obtain upright labels on the segment
Definition at line 132 of file qgstextrendererutils.h.
QVector< QgsTextRendererUtils::CurvedGraphemePlacement > QgsTextRendererUtils::CurvePlacementProperties::graphemePlacement |
Placement information for all graphemes in text.
Definition at line 126 of file qgstextrendererutils.h.
bool QgsTextRendererUtils::CurvePlacementProperties::labeledLineSegmentIsRightToLeft = false |
true
if labeled section of line is calculated to be of right-to-left orientation
Definition at line 130 of file qgstextrendererutils.h.
int QgsTextRendererUtils::CurvePlacementProperties::upsideDownCharCount = 0 |
Total count of upside down characters.
Definition at line 128 of file qgstextrendererutils.h.